
What exactly does ‘layer compression crushing’ mean in the context of a cone crusher
As a commonly used medium-sized crushing machine in the mining industry, the cone crusher is widely appreciated for its structural performance. Its high output, stable performance, and ease of automation control have made it a leading direction in crusher development. Cone crushers perform well when crushing materials of medium hardness or higher, with a wide range of compression ratio control, good output and quality, uniform particle size, and low energy consumption. However, early cone crushers had a drawback: the finished product contained a high proportion of needle-like and flake-like particles, resulting in poor particle shape. However, after 1980, some scholars proposed the theory of layer compression crushing. Additionally, many manufacturers often mention that their cone crushers utilise the layer compression crushing principle, resulting in better product particle shape, when introducing their products to customers.
What exactly is layer compression crushing? What conditions must be met to achieve layer compression crushing?
When materials are mutually compressed and ground, and crushing occurs at their cracks and defects, this process is referred to as layer compression crushing. Under normal circumstances, in the actual operation of a cone crusher, single-particle crushing only occurs when the material size is large or the crushing chamber dimensions are too small to form an effective crushing layer. In such cases, single-particle crushing only occurs at the feed and discharge openings. Material-to-material compression inevitably occurs, and most crushing takes place under these conditions, meaning that layer compression crushing occurs throughout the rest of the crushing chamber.
Materials crushed using the layered crushing principle result in more uniform material, with a higher proportion of cubic-shaped particles and a high content of fine-grained material, thereby better aligning with the ‘more crushing, less grinding’ theory.
